Bwindi Impenetrable National Park,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, offers thrilling gorilla trekking and rich biodiversity with over 120 mammals and 350 bird species. Explore dense rainforest, spot endangered mountain gorillas, and engage with indigenous Batwa culture. Queen Elizabeth National Park features diverse landscapes from savannahs to wetlands, boasting tree-climbing lions in Ishasha and scenic boat cruises on the Kazinga Channel. Witness elephants, hippos, crocodiles, and over 600 bird species. Discover Uganda’s top safari destinations for unforgettable wildlife encounters and cultural experiences.
